Buyer’s Guide: 3 Key Factors to Consider

Durability and Protection

Choose a product that not only shines but also protects. A high-quality polish with built-in sealants or polymers creates a barrier against brake dust, road salt, and UV rays, reducing future cleaning and reapplication.

Ease of Use and Application

Consider your available time and patience. Liquid polishes often work faster on large areas, while pastes provide more control for intricate designs. For beginners, an all-in-one cleaner-and-polish can significantly simplify the process.

Price vs. Performance

The most expensive option isn’t always necessary. A reliable mid-range product typically offers excellent results for daily drivers. Reserve premium, professional-grade polishes for show cars or wheels that require heavy correction.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: How often should I polish my alloy wheels?

A1: For regular maintenance, a light polish every 3-4 months is sufficient. If wheels are heavily soiled or oxidized, a thorough polish may be needed 1-2 times a year.

Q2: Can I use regular car wax on my wheels?

A2: It’s not recommended. Wheel-specific products are formulated to withstand higher braking temperatures and repel aggressive brake dust more effectively.

Q3: Is it necessary to remove the wheel to polish it properly?

A3: While taking the wheel off allows for the most thorough cleaning, it’s not always required. Many high-quality polishes can be applied with the wheel still on the vehicle. Just be sure to work carefully around the brake components.

Q4: Will polishing remove scratches from my alloy wheels?

A4: Polishing can significantly reduce the visibility of light surface scratches and swirl marks. For deeper scratches, gouges, or curb rash, you’ll likely need professional repair or sanding before polishing becomes effective.

Q5: What’s the difference between a polish and a cleaner?

A5: A wheel cleaner is formulated to break down and remove grime, brake dust, and dirt. A polish contains gentle abrasives that work to eliminate oxidation and minor flaws, and it usually leaves a protective, glossy layer behind.
